Work With SNAP-ED

The mission of the Department of Health (DOH) SNAP-Ed program is to improve health equity through projects and interventions that support healthy lifestyle behaviors and increase food security. DOH works with organizations that are eager to create change in their community while simultaneously contributing to a larger body of SNAP-Ed work that achieves impact at regional and state levels.
